From song lyrics to gang signs, how does society cause toxic masculinity?
An urgent call to unravel masculinity and redefine it, prize-winning writer JJ Bola explores masculinity, finding it at the heart of love and sex, the political stage, competitive sports, gang culture, mental health issues and more.
“An antidote to Jordan Peterson” – Guardian
In Mask Off, JJ Bola exposes masculinity as a performance that men are socially conditioned into. Using examples of non-Western cultural traditions, music and sport, he shines light on historical narratives around manhood, debunking popular myths along the way. Mask Off explores how LGBTQ men, men of colour, and male refugees experience masculinity in diverse ways, revealing its fluidity, how it's strengthened and weakened by different political contexts, such as the patriarchy or the far-right, and perceived differently by those around them.

JJ Bola is a prize-winning Writer, Poet, and Educator, born in Kinshasa, Democratic Republic of Congo, and raised in London.
He is the author of the novels ‘The Selfless Act of Breathing’ (2021), 'No Place to Call Home' (2017), three poetry collections and a children’s picture book called Fly Boy (2023).
One of the winners of the 2017 Spread the Word Flight 1000 Associates Prize, he is also a High Profile Supporter for the United Nations High Council for Refugees. JJ has an MA in Creative Writing from Birkbeck University and also works as a Mental Health Social Worker, in a community mental health team
JJ Bola is based in London, but often travels across the UK, and internationally, for workshops, lectures, and talks. He is passionate about empowering people to transform their lives. And loves basketball, and carrot cake.
